Today's Flower photos I wanted to share with you the simple Dandelion. 

This is pretty standard photo. 
The Dandelion as a whole is in focus and has a blurry background.

The photo below was taken by focusing on the center of the Dandelion.
This blurred the outer flower of the seed that is closest to me.
It allowed me to sharpen the very center.


The photo below I did the opposite of the photo above. 
I focused the outer flower of the seed.
Thus, I blurred the very center of the Dandelion.


There are so many different ways to see the same thing.
